RESUMING THE FIFTH LAP Embarkation II ( Days 1 - 13) Index: The Fifth Lap Expeditio n Previous: Pausing and returning to Sydney Photo Album: Embarkation to Port Wakefield After a year ensuring the family's well-being, it was finally time to resume the paused Fifth Lap. Sandi, the trusty vehicle, had been meticulously prepared with short camping trips, a new electric rooftop air-conditioner, and a brand-new engine. After a few weeks of diligent repairs and maintenance, Sandi was Outback ready. Initially, the plan was to head towards the Oodnadatta Track and check out the Maree Man. However, there was a growing desire to visit Melbourne to see old friends missed on the last trip and to attend a reunion of old colleagues from Labtam. As one of the four founders 59 years ago, it had been nearly 40 years since seeing some of these friends, some had since become grandparents. The choice was simple: head south to Victoria first.
